Title: The Innovations of Jeffrey Martin Green
Introduction
Jeffrey Martin Green is an accomplished inventor based in Brentwood, TN (US). He has made significant contributions to the field of containerized computing, holding two patents that showcase his innovative approach to technology.
Latest Patents
One of his latest patents is titled "Admission control in a containerized computing environment." This method involves deploying a containerized computing environment and managing admission control based on security constraints. The process includes determining a quality metric for the container and applying admission control to allow or disallow the creation of the container based on these metrics.
Another notable patent is "Security of network traffic in a containerized computing environment." This method focuses on monitoring a computing environment with multiple containers. It involves determining service types and IP addresses for containers, applying different security policies based on the source of network traffic, and ensuring secure processing for each container.
